Grapefruit juice - Answer-CYP 450 inhibitor - Intake leads to increased pharmacologic effect of drugs Warfarin - Answer-Interacts with TMP-SMX, erythromycin, Flagyl, Diflucan => Increases INR (Increased bleeding and hemorrhaging) Tetracycline - Answer-- Do not take with milk products Clarithromycin - Answer-- Avoid mixing with lovastatin, simvastatin, and calcium channel blockers - when mixed with the statins listed, it is metabolized quickly - when mixed with calcium channel blockers, it can cause kidney injury TMP/SMX (Bactrim) - Answer-Interacts with Warfarin => Increased INR - Avoid mixing withACE inhibitors and ARBs Metronidazole (Flagyl) - Answer-Do not drink alcohol while taking or 24-48 hours after (this includes medications with alcohol) Cimetidine (Tagamet) - Answer-CYP 450 inhibitor MANY drug to drug interactions- Warfarin - Calcium Channel blockers - Metronidazole ACE inhibitors - Answer-Must be stopped before switching to an ARNI (36-48 hours) due to the risk of angioedema that can occur when these meds are combined with ARNIs - do not combine with ARBs
